Hidden Anatomy in Sacred Art
Is there a human brain hidden behind God in Michelangelo's Creation of Adam? Is the Eye of Horus a map of the brain, the djed pillar a spine, the pine cone in the Vatican a pineal gland? This richly illustrated book tells nine famous "hidden anatomy" discoveries as the adventures they are — the Sistine Chapel, Leonardo, Egypt, the horn of Amun, Jacob's ladder, Rembrandt's anatomy lesson — and then says honestly what art historians and anatomists can prove and what is interpretation.
